Abstract

This case study is a comparison study of leisure activities between the arts and sciences students in University of Malaya. The aim of the study is to find out the difference in the type of leisure activity pursued by the arts and Sciences students. In order to provide a clear and systematical picture, the writer has arranged this study into various chapters. Chapter I gives a general introduction of the objective and significance of this study. It also discusses the research methodology used and the problems encountered during the fieldwork. Chapter II present the meaning and use of leisure as well as its concepts, functions and types of leisure activity. Chapter III deals the factors to be considered in determining the type of leisure activity. It also touches on various aspects of education which affect the students leisure. Chapter IV given a deeper understanding on the various types of leisure activities pursued by the arts and science students. Chapter V attempts to describe the views and satisfaction of leisure from the students point of view. Finally, the conclusion analysis the findings and implication of the study. The writer concludes by putting forward suggestions and recommendations.
